In CTC, R&S 4 is one of the choices and it is scheduled at half-pace, normally the first half of the book. What I think I would do in your situation is just pick up where you left off and do R&S4 half-pace and plan on finishing it with CTC. Probably doing one lesson every time it is scheduled except doing reviews over 2 days and writing lessons over 2 days would be about the usual pace. Then when you move onto RTR, you can do R&S5. I think that would work out fine.
